Appendix A
Statement of Task
An ad hoc committee will plan and conduct a 1-day public workshop on the effects of involvement with the juvenile justice system on the health of adolescents, families, and communities of color. The committee will define the specific topics to be discussed, develop the agenda, suggest and invite speakers, and moderate workshop discussions. This workshop may include discussions of youth confinement, adverse childhood events, policing practices, and the potential influence of mental health problems and substance use on involvement with the juvenile justice system. An individually authored proceedings of the presentations and discussions at the workshop will be prepared by a designated rapporteur in accordance with institutional guidelines.
The planning committee will comprise individuals with expertise in juvenile justice, health disparities, and mental health/substance use issues.
